PowerPC e300
Power Architektúra |
---|
NXP (volt Freescale és Motorola) |
PowerPC e sorozat (2006) (
e200
• e300
• e500
• e600
• e5500
• e6500 )
|
IBM |
POWER ISA (1990)
• POWER sorozat (1990)
|
IBM-Nintendo együttműködés |
Egyéb |
Titan • PWRficient • Cell • Xenon • X704 |
Kapcsolódó hivatkozások |
OpenPOWER Alapítvány
• AIM alliance
• RISC
• Blue Gene
• Power.org
• PAPR
• PReP
• CHRP
• AltiVec
• tovább...
|
A PowerPC e300 egy PowerPC architektúrájú 32 bites RISC mikroprocesszor-család, amit a Freescale fejlesztett ki, elsősorban legfeljebb 800 MHz-es sebességű egylapkás rendszerekben (SoC) való használatra, beágyazott alkalmazásokhoz.
Felépítés
[szerkesztés]Az e300 egy szuperskalár RISC mag, egységesen 16 KiB vagy 32 KiB méretű (Harvard-architektúrájú) utasítás- és adat-gyorsítótárral, négy fokozatú utasítás-futószalaggal, betöltő/tároló egységgel, rendszerregiszterekkel, egy elágazásjósló egységgel, fixpontos egységgel és opcionális kétszeres pontosságú FPU-val. Nem kompatibilis az aktuális Power ISA-val, hanem teljesen visszafelé kompatibilis a régebbi G2 és PowerPC 603e magokkal, amelyből származik.
Magok
[szerkesztés]Az e300-as magokat számos SoC termékben felhasználják, amelyek a legkülönbözőbb alkalmazási területekhez készülnek.
MPC51xx
[szerkesztés]A MPC51xx és MPC52xx autóipari és ipari vezérlő processzorok családja.
Az MPC5121e és MPC5123 32 bites AXE egységgel[1] rendelkezik az audio-feldolgozás gyorsításához és egy integrált képernyővezérlővel. Az MPC51xx mag mindkét változata elérhető maximálisan 400 MHz-es órajellel, az MPC5121e pedig egy (PowerVR) MBX Lite 2D/3D grafikus magot is tartalmaz.[2]
Az AXE egység egy külön 200 MHz-es RISC mikroprocesszorral rendelkezik, amelynek két számítási egysége van: egy skalár fixpontos egység, amely egy általános 32 bites utasításkészletet valósít meg, és egy 48 bites fixpontos feldolgozó egység. Vektoros műveletekkel is rendelkezik, és egycsatornás DMA-val. Az AXE célja, hogy a fő rendszer CPU-ját tehermentesítse a számítási és adatáramlás-intenzív műveletek (például: digitális jelfeldolgozás és tömörített audió kódolás/dekódolás) alól.[3]
MPC52xx
[szerkesztés]Az MPC5200 mag elsősorban a PowerPC 603e (G2 LE mag) magon alapul, amely nagyon hasonló az e300 maghoz. Tartalmaz egy kétszeres pontosságú FPU-t, egy memóriavezérlő egységet (MMU) az adatokhoz és utasításokhoz, 16 KiB adat- és utasítás-gyorsítótárat, egy komplex DMA-vezérlőt (BestComm) a be/kimeneti műveletekhez, egy SDR/DDR RAM-vezérlőt (max. 266 MHz), egy Ethernet MAC-et (100 MBps), egy USB 1.1 interfészt, hat programozható soros vezérlőt és két I²C soros sínvezérlőt.
Az MPC5200B lapka ennek egy zsugorított (die shrink) változata, valamivel hatékonyabb DMA-vezérlővel és alacsonyabb energiafogyasztással.
Mindkét változat legfeljebb 400 MHz-es órajellel elérhető.
MSC712x
[szerkesztés]Digitális jelprocesszor-sorozat (DSP), elsősorban optikai hálózatokhoz.
Az MSC7120 GPON egy beágyazott rendszer (SoC) megoldás szélessávú passzív optikai hálózatvégződés (ONT, optical network termination) alkalmazásokhoz, optikai hálózati processzor és integrált DSP egység.[4] Tartalmazza a GPON (Gigabit Passive Optical Network) TC/MAC[5] implementációt, a StarCore DSP-t, a Gigabit Ethernet TC/MAC-okat és az óra- és adatvisszaállító egységet (CDR) a Power Architecture technológiára épülő magban. 266 MHz-es órajelen működik.[6]
Az MSC7104 GPON hasonlóan szélessávú passzív optikai hálózatvégződések számára készült, de hiányzik belőle a DSP. A benne lévő e300 mag 266 MHz-en működik, és 16 KiB utasítás- és 16 KiB adat gyorsítótárat tartalmaz. Az MSC7104 az MSC7120 eszköz alacsony költségű változata.[7]
MPC83xx
[szerkesztés]Az MPC83xx PowerQUICC II Pro telekommunikációs és hálózati processzorok családja.
Jegyzetek
[szerkesztés]- ↑ AXE: Auxiliary Execution Engine, kiegészítő végrehajtó motor
- ↑ MPC5121E/MPC5123 Data Sheet (angol nyelven) (pdf). docs pp. 1/88. NXP, Freescale, 2010, 2012. (Hozzáférés: 2024. június 1.)
- ↑ MPC5121e Microcontroller Reference Manual (angol nyelven) (pdf). docs pp. 168/1371. NXP, Freescale, 2012. június. (Hozzáférés: 2024. június 1.)
- ↑ MSC7120 GPON: Integrated GPON ONT System-on-Chip. Freescale , 2007 [2011. június 7-i dátummal az eredetiből archiválva].
- ↑ TC/MAC: transport-controlled MAC protocol
- ↑ MSC7120 GPON: Integrated GPON ONT System-on-Chip (angol nyelven) (pdf). docs pp. 1/2. NXP, Freescale, 2007. március. (Hozzáférés: 2024. június 1.)
- ↑ MSC7104 GPON: Integrated GPON ONT System-on-Chip (angol nyelven) (pdf). docs pp. 1/2. NXP, Freescale, 2007. augusztus. (Hozzáférés: 2024. június 1.)
Fordítás
[szerkesztés]Ez a szócikk részben vagy egészben a PowerPC e300 című német Wikipédia-szócikk ezen változatának fordításán alapul. Az eredeti cikk szerkesztőit annak laptörténete sorolja fel. Ez a jelzés csupán a megfogalmazás eredetét és a szerzői jogokat jelzi, nem szolgál a cikkben szereplő információk forrásmegjelöléseként.
Források
[szerkesztés]- e300 Core Family Reference (PDF; 3,59 MB)
- MPC5200 Data Sheet (PDF; 6,6 MB)
- MSC7120 termékreferencia (PDF; 228 KiB)